Current Distribution on a Rotating Disk Electrode [PDF]
The radial variation of deposit thickness on a rotating disk electrode was measured for deposition of copper from a solution and . The results confirm the theory of nonuniform current distribution on such electrodes below the limiting current.

Load Distributing Metamaterials Via Discrete Optimization
Mechanical metamaterials are computationally optimized to homogenize transmitted forces by minimizing the spread of reaction forces. The resulting architectures transform localized loading into broader, more uniform force distributions and experimentally demonstrate robust load spreading under quasi‐static and impact loading.

Electron‐Deficient Linkers Enhance H2O2 Electrosynthesis in Covalent Organic Frameworks
Linker π‐conjugation modulates the electronic state of the Ni–N4 centers and their interaction with the key *OOH intermediate while preserving the primary coordination motif. NiPc‐PTDA delivers an H2O2 selectivity of 92% and a production rate of 34.8 mol gcat−1 h−1, highlighting linker electronic properties as a molecular design parameter for NiPc ...
